Bola Ahmed Tinubu, the presidential candidate of the All Progressives Congress (APC), has said that fuel scarcity and Naira redesign are clear acts of sabotage meant to compromise next month’s election.
The former Governor of Lagos State made this known while speaking at the MKO Abiola Stadium, Kuto, Abeokuta Ogun State, during the APC presidential campaign.
“They don’t want this election to hold. They want to sabotage it. Will you allow them?”, Tinubu asked his supporters at the MKO Abiola Stadium, Kuto, Abeokuta.
Tinubu however, vowed that Nigerians would defy the fuel scarcity and trek to cast their votes, adding that the forthcoming polls would be a superior revolution.
“They have started coming up with the issue of ‘no fuel’. Don’t worry, if there is no fuel, we will trek to cast the vote.
“If you like increase price of fuel, hide the fuel or change the ink on the Naira notes, we will win the election,” he said.
The Independent Petroleum Marketers Association of Nigeria recently said there is confusion in the oil sector in Nigeria, following the prolonged fuel scarcity that has been hitting hard on the country for months.
